Overview and Description:

The Penn Medicine Diabetes Center at 145 King of Prussia Road in Radnor, PA, is a premier destination for comprehensive diabetes care, led by Dr. Carrie M. Burns, MD. As part of the renowned Penn Medicine network, the center is committed to providing exceptional, patient-centered care for individuals living with diabetes and related endocrine disorders. Dr. Burns, a highly respected physician specializing in endocrinology, diabetes, and metabolism, brings years of expertise and a compassionate approach to every patient interaction.

At the Penn Medicine Diabetes Center, patients benefit from a multidisciplinary approach that combines the latest advancements in diabetes management with personalized care plans. The center serves adults with all types of diabetes, including type 1, type 2, gestational diabetes, and rare forms of the disease. The team is dedicated to helping patients achieve optimal health outcomes through education, support, and evidence-based medical interventions.

Dr. Carrie M. Burns is board-certified in endocrinology and internal medicine, and she is recognized for her leadership in diabetes care and research. Her clinical interests include the management of complex diabetes cases, insulin pump therapy, continuous glucose monitoring, and the prevention of diabetes-related complications. Dr. Burns is also actively involved in clinical research and education, ensuring that her patients have access to the most current and effective treatment options available.

The Penn Medicine Diabetes Center offers a wide range of services, including comprehensive diabetes evaluations, medication management, nutritional counseling, and lifestyle modification support. The center is equipped with state-of-the-art diagnostic tools and technology, enabling precise monitoring and tailored treatment plans. Patients can also access advanced therapies such as insulin pump management, continuous glucose monitoring systems, and the latest medications for diabetes and related conditions.

Education is a cornerstone of the care provided at the center. Patients and their families receive individualized education on blood sugar monitoring, medication administration, healthy eating, physical activity, and strategies for managing stress and preventing complications. The team works closely with each patient to develop realistic goals and empower them to take an active role in their health.

The Penn Medicine Diabetes Center is committed to a collaborative approach, working in partnership with primary care providers, specialists, and other healthcare professionals to ensure seamless, coordinated care. The center also offers telemedicine appointments, making it easier for patients to access expert care from the comfort of their homes.

Located in Radnor, PA, the center is easily accessible to residents of the greater Philadelphia area and surrounding communities. The facility is designed to provide a welcoming and supportive environment, with convenient parking and modern amenities to enhance the patient experience.

In addition to direct patient care, Dr. Burns and the Penn Medicine Diabetes Center are involved in ongoing research and clinical trials aimed at advancing the understanding and treatment of diabetes. Patients may have the opportunity to participate in research studies, gaining access to innovative therapies and contributing to the future of diabetes care.
